Harness transmission peugeot 308cc 308sw rcz connector c4l automatic 9804315380 automatic transmission harness connector;engine attachment
9804315380 Automatic transmission harness connector;Engine Attachment
9804315380 Automatic transmission harness connector;Engine Attachment